Home built Bula Defense Systems M14 10-X target rifle.

Work in progress. Got a new Bula standard receiver in that just had to be turned into a target rifle. Barrel is a Bula heavy 1/10 22" .308. Most parts are Bula. Headspace is set at 1.632 using a PT&G M118 carbide finish reamer. Trigger group is usgi SA with no modifications or tuning. Scope is a Hi-Lux Dominator XR 6-30x56-R mounted on a Bassett low picatinny rail with ARMS 22 quick disconnect rings. Cheek riser is one of my TAC-PRO kydex velcro attach units. Action is bedded in an extra heavy NM walnut stock.

Targets were shot off a front rest with rear bunny bag at 100 yds using 155 gn Berger hybrid target bullets , 43.5 gn of Varget in MEN berdan cases set off with Tula berdan primers. Load development, underway, indicates that an increase in powder weight should be helpful in achieving the 10-X goal which is well within the capabilities of this rifle.
